Output 89640bb199434c1a37267964278d40b5e253d58e672e855ac5f9b7e569192db4:0

value
30666
script pubkey
OP_0 OP_PUSHBYTES_32 3aab0f3781fb2747e48b67cb52beaefd9d655a4f7be39949d93c6d170e3e0030
address
bc1q824s7duplvn50eytvl94904wlkwk2kj0003ejjwe83k3wr37qqcq3eetlv
transaction
89640bb199434c1a37267964278d40b5e253d58e672e855ac5f9b7e569192db4
spent
true